| 2.4.2004 |
A campus committe has been charged by the Chancellor and Provost
to consider matters such as priority to purchase homes in the
West Village neighborhood. The committee consists of campus
planners, and faculty and staff representatives. The committee's
recommendations are due to be transmitted to the Chancellor
and Provost in July 2004. |

| 3.1.2005 |
UC Davis has selected its development partner for the first phase of
the new West Village neighborhood
West Village Community Partnership LLC is a joint venture of Urban Villages -- Davis LLC of Denver and Carmel Partners Inc. of San Francisco. The West Village partnership is led by...[ More ] |
